Production of recombinant CAMP – Sialidase protein and preparation of chitosan nanoparticles carrying this protein to be used as a candidate for vaccines targeting Propionibacterium acnes
BACKGROUND AND OBJECTIVE: Acne vulgaris is one of the most common skin diseases that imposes too much mental pressure and high costs on patients.
